Content Curation Tips: A Simple Post Format
Explore internetbillboards.net (Aug 17 2012) Industry & Business News , Tips & Best Practices
A few simple tips to note while you're curating content.
The simplest format is to take a piece of content – be it another post by someone else, an image or a video – introduce it (tell why you’re sharing it), then share it (with attribution and a link to the original piece), then share your thoughts/conclusions about it.

7 smart techniques for content curation
Explore Social media consulting for nonprofits (Aug 15 2012) Industry & Business News
How to use content curation for non-profits.
Heard of content curation? It’s the process of sifting through information on the Web — from articles to images to videos to tweets — to organize, filter and make sense of content and then to share the very best material with your network.
